APA Photo Citation | Reference Page & In-Text Examples

    https://www.bibme.org/citation-guide/APA/photograph/
    Citing a photograph. APA format structure: Photographer, A. (Publication Year, Month Day). Title or description of photograph [Photograph]. Name of Museum, Location of Museum. URL (if available) APA format example: Roege, W. J. (1938). St. Patrick’s cathedral, fifth avenue from 50th street to 51st street [Photograph]. New York Historical Society, New York, …

How do I cite a photograph in a personal collection?

    https://style.mla.org/citing-a-personal-photograph/
    To cite a photograph in a personal collection, follow the MLA format template. List the author of the photograph, if known. Then provide a description of the photograph in place of a title. List the date the photograph was taken, if known. In the optional-element slot at the end of the entry, indicate that the photograph is in a personal collection:

How do I cite and reference a photo I have taken myself?

    https://libanswers.mmu.ac.uk/faq/183429
    In theory, you do not need to cite and reference a photograph that you have taken yourself as you are the creator of the photograph. However, if you are inserting the photo into your work, you would need to add a caption beneath any illustration within the main body of your work, ie, giving the photo a title, as follows: Figure 1: Title of photo. How should I reference personal photographs using the …

    https://writeanswers.royalroads.ca/faq/199066
    If the personal photographs are yours and they haven't been published elsewhere, "no citation or copyright attribution is required in the figure note" (American Psychological Association [APA], 2020, p. 230).
